CTI is seeking to appoint a Head of Operations (Payments) for a leading payment service provider.
Location: London/Hybrid
Salary: £120K-£140K
Essential: Recent experience within Banking or FinTech sectors
Competencies:
- 15+ years' experience in an operational leadership capacity within the highly regulated environments (Banking or FinTech)
- A solid history of successful project management, team scaling, and achieving exceptional outcomes in a fast-paced, hands-on setting
- In-depth knowledge of payment systems, card schemes, and settlement processes
- Proven ability to lead significant change initiatives, effectively managing transitions and aligning new processes with organisational objectives and team strengths
- Demonstrated expertise in process optimisation and the implementation of customer-focused strategies
- Strong analytical skills, capable of utilising data to inform decision-making and enhance process efficiencies
- Experience in overseeing budgets and personnel within an operations division, ensuring optimal resource utilisation
- Proficient in addressing and resolving complex payment-related challenges
- Comprehensive understanding of Compliance, AML, KYC regulations and procedures
- Exceptional communication and interpersonal abilities, facilitating engagement with stakeholders across all organisational levels
- Proven capacity to excel in a rapidly changing, dynamic work environment
